Kula Maui Real Estate, Lifestyle, Upcountry Living and Community Guide

Kula is one of Maui’s most desirable Upcountry communities, known for its expansive views, cooler climate, and rural residential lifestyle. Located on the slopes of Haleakalā, the Kula area also includes Ulupalakua and Kanaio, which extend further south and offer even more open land and agricultural surroundings. These areas are connected by the scenic drive along the backside of Haleakalā toward Hāna, known for its open landscapes and remote beauty. Together, they provide a more private and spacious alternative to Maui’s coastal regions, with a strong focus on land, elevation, and long-term livability. This is a region where ownership is centered around space, privacy, and a connection to Maui’s natural landscape.

Lifestyle in Kula

Life in Kula is quiet, spacious, and rooted in Upcountry living. The area is defined by larger parcels, agricultural properties, and residential homes set across rolling hillside terrain. Ulupalakua and Kanaio offer an even more rural extension of this lifestyle, with wide open landscapes, fewer homes, and a deeper connection to agriculture and ranch land. Residents enjoy cooler temperatures, bi-coastal ocean views, and a slower pace compared to South and West Maui. Kula attracts full-time residents, second homeowners, and those seeking privacy, space, and a more land-oriented Maui lifestyle.

Parks, Open Space, and Outdoor Living

Kula offers access to extensive open space, scenic drives, and outdoor recreation throughout Upcountry Maui. Popular spots include Kula Botanical Garden, known for its curated gardens, walking paths, and native and tropical plant collections. Kula Lavender Farm is a well-known destination offering panoramic views, walking trails, and seasonal lavender blooms, creating a unique Upcountry outdoor experience. Further south, MauiWine provides a combination of open grounds, historic structures, and vineyard landscapes, often visited for tastings and events. The elevation throughout Kula supports an outdoor lifestyle centered around nature, gardening, and enjoying cooler, breezier conditions.

Agriculture, Dining, and Local Amenities

Kula is known for its strong agricultural presence, including farms, ranches, and locally grown produce. Dining options reflect the area’s local character and include well-known spots such as Kula Lodge Restaurant, La Provence, Kula Bistro, and Grandma's Coffee House, offering a mix of casual dining and Upcountry favorites. Ulupalakua adds a well-known winery experience through MauiWine, contributing to the area's food and beverage identity. For everyday needs, residents typically shop in nearby Pukalani and Makawao, with options like Pukalani Superette and Foodland Pukalani providing groceries and essentials. Additional amenities include local schools, small markets, and services that support full-time Upcountry living, along with fitness and wellness options such as yoga studios and an Anytime Fitness location nearby.

Location and Accessibility

Kula is located in Upcountry Maui along the mid to upper slopes of Haleakalā.
It is approximately 20 to 35 minutes from Kahului and the main airport, depending on elevation and location. Ulupalakua and Kanaio are located further south and are more remote, often experienced along the scenic drive toward Hāna on the backside of the island. While more removed from Maui’s resort areas, Kula remains accessible to Central Maui and the North Shore.

Kula Real Estate

Kula real estate includes single-family homes, agricultural properties, and large rural estates. Properties often feature expansive lot sizes, privacy, and panoramic ocean and mountain views.
Ulupalakua and Kanaio offer some of the most spacious and rural properties on Maui, often with significant acreage and agricultural use. The area is known for Agricultural zoning, which influences how land can be used and developed. Ownership in Kula is typically focused on full-time living, second homes, or long-term investment centered around land and lifestyle. Each property may vary in zoning, water access, and infrastructure, making individual review essential when evaluating Kula real estate opportunities.

FAQ Kula Maui Real Estate and Living

What is Kula known for?
Kula is known for its Upcountry location, cooler climate, large properties, and bi-coastal ocean views.

Is Kula a good place to live full-time?
Yes, Kula is a popular choice for full-time residents seeking privacy, space, and a quieter lifestyle.

What types of homes are in Kula?
Kula includes single-family homes, agricultural properties, and large estates with expansive land.

What are Ulupalakua and Kanaio?
Ulupalakua and Kanaio are rural areas within the greater Kula region, known for ranch land, agriculture, and larger, more remote properties along the backside of Haleakalā on the way to Hana.

Does Kula have beaches?
Kula is an inland Upcountry community and does not have beaches, but South Maui and North Shore beaches are within driving distance.

How far is Kula from Kahului?
Kula is approximately 20 to 35 minutes from Kahului, depending on location.
